I have done a lot of research on triggers because i really want to put one in my tank when everything is ready. This includes book and online research and asking lots of questions at my LFS, employees of which are very knowledgable.(all have to pass the M-1 certification test before handling costumers)
From my research i have decided that Riggens Trigger, Pink Tail Trigger, Blue Throat Trigger, and Crosshatch trigger can all be kept with not only smaller fish, but in a reef tank with limited to no damage.
